I have the aux. guages installed near the cup holders. Very cool looking, and very early 1960s retro look to them... Question: What is normal for oil temperature? Guage is hash marked at 50, 100, 120, and 150 degrees centigrate. Seems to hoover around 110 centigrate during normal operation, which would be about 225 degrees F. Pretty sure that's normal. At what temperature does it become abnormally high??

Gauges are intended to be viewed in a single glance. Nobody is really supposed to read the numbers on an Analog Gauge. That is why when the needle is pointing straight up (or roughly so). All is OK. Obviously, if its 15 degrees or more off center, then look more closely at it.
